The Han Attack (漢攻撃, Kan Kōgeki, Man's Han Attack) is a Unite Attack in Suikoden III.

Information

This unite attack could be used by any two of the manly group of Wan Fu, Mua, and Leo Galan. It seems the attack could only be used by the most manly of manly men, a criteria each of the three clearly met.

The chosen two would attack the enemy in a crossing motion, and then deliver a finishing below with the character "漢" appearing in the background. Both of the attackers would become unbalanced after the attack, but would deal a devastating blow to all enemies within range in the process.
